Temporary changes in respect of publicity for planning policy documents and planning applications during the COVID-19 crisis.
That the Temporary Changes Addendum be approved and
published alongside the Bracknell Forest Statement of Community
Involvement (2014).
National Planning Practice Guidance1 requires local planning authorities to assess
their SCIs to identify whether elements are inconsistent with public health guidelines
and restrictions in place due to the COVID-19 pandemic. Any temporary
amendments that are necessary should then be made. The Bracknell Forest SCI has
been reviewed and areas have been identified where it is considered necessary to
make temporary amendments to enable plan making and other activities to continue.
The main alternative is not to publish the “Addendum” to the SCI but to rely on the
adopted SCI. However as set out in paragraph 3.1 above, the Council is unable to
meet its full consultation and engagement commitments during the COVID-19
pandemic. This could potentially result in failure of the Central and Eastern Berkshire
Joint Minerals and Waste Local Plan and the Bracknell Forest Local Plan to meet the
legal compliance test on Examination and expose the Council to the risk of legal
challenges. It is considered that approval and publication of the “Addendum” is the
most appropriate option.
